Hotels & Resorts Market Insights

2026 Tourism Surge Drives Demand

Boston’s tourism sector is preparing for a record rebound in 2026, fueled by the 250th anniversary of the U.S., FIFA World Cup, and Tall Ships events. These global gatherings are expected to draw millions of visitors, increasing pressure on hotel front desks to handle volume without added staffing.

Over $1 billion in economic impact anticipated for Greater Boston tourism in 2026

Post-2025 Recovery Momentum

Despite a turbulent summer in 2025 with sluggish occupancy rates, Boston’s hospitality industry is rebuilding through coordinated planning and infrastructure readiness. Hotels are now investing in scalable solutions to handle future surges without overstaffing.

Tourism recovery anticipated for 2026 after a challenging 2025

International Visitor Spending Soars

In 2024, international visitors spent $2.72 billion in Boston, a 13% increase from the previous year. With average spending of $1,066 per trip, every missed call represents a significant loss in revenue potential for Boston hotels and resorts.
